Bella Paige

Bella, who turns 14 in late October, lives in South West Melbourne, and has Macedonian parents who migrated with their families as very young children.

Bella has a real love for all things musical and started her training at 6 years old. She has already had impressive experience in a live singing contest and performing in front of a large audience. Bella was the very first child to audition on ‘The Voice Kids Australia’ and went the whole distance to the Grand Final, finishing as the runner-up in 2014. She signed with Universal Music Australia in April 2014 and her Junior Eurovision Song Contest entry, ‘My Girls’ is her debut single.

Dance is also in her repertoire, from ballet and jazz to hip-hop. And when needed Bella can draw on her Taekwondo training too, winning gold medals in this martial arts sport at a national level.

Bella is looking forward to meeting the other Junior Eurovision participants, and performing on a global stage. She is also excited to sing a song co-written by Australian superstar, Delta Goodrem, who she met during her experience on “The Voice Kids Australia”.

Her family are her biggest inspirations having an older sister who is also a singer, a brother who plays football in the Youth League for Melbourne City Football Club, and an amazing stylist and number 1 supporter in her mum.
Bella and her family have been watching Eurovision for many years on SBS, and is looking forward to feeling closer to her Macedonian heritage when she performs in Bulgaria.

Bella’s ambition is to be an international musical recording and live performance artist, and says her biggest musical role models are Beyoncé, Rihanna, Jessie J, Christina Aguilera and Jennifer Hudson.
